Clos Haut-Peyraguey Sauternes Kosher
2014
750ML
This impressive wine has great intensity and superb apricot and orange flavors. Acidity mingles with its botrytis core and rich, concentrated fruit, striking a fine balance. It will become delicious as it matures. Drink from 2024. The 2014 Clos Haut-Peyraguey has a slightly pinched bouquet at first, some warmth coming from the glass that detracts from its delineation.
